In this video, Griffen Hoyle, Head of Content at Crafty Counsel, sits down with Tom Evans, Legal Operations Consultant at Norton Rose Fulbright, to explore the real drivers of successful legal change and why it all starts with relationships.

Tom shares his perspective on why meaningful transformation isn’t just about tech or process. Drawing on his experience supporting in-house legal teams, he highlights how change succeeds when legal teams focus on people first, from early engagement through to long-term adoption.

He describes legal operations as a bit like being a doctor for your legal team – diagnosing the symptoms of ineffective workflows, then helping legal and business stakeholders build something better.

Tom offers a practical, people-first approach to legal change:

Change is about people not just process
Whether you’re adopting new tools or rethinking workflows, relationships are the glue that holds everything together. Trust, alignment and early conversations makes change stick.

Change is social not rational
Tom challenges the idea that good solutions sell themselves. Building trust is key for effective initial engagement. He encourages legal teams to ask: “How will this feel for the people involved?” and “What questions or fears might they have?”

Map your most valuable allies
Tom outlines three key relationship groups that in-house counsel should cultivate to drive successful change:

  • Users and champions – people affected by the change, and those who can help lead it
  • Executive sponsors – senior leaders who can unify messaging and reinforce accountability
  • Operational allies – teams like IT and Finance, who might not be the focus, but can make or break implementation

Build trust through consistency and feedback
From one-to-ones to celebrating small wins, Tom shares how a mix of touchpoints builds momentum and buy-in. He highlights the power of acting on feedback and letting people know when their input has made a practical impact, and how this ultimately builds mutual trust.
